Most Lake Ronkonkoma bathroom renovations cost between $15,000 and $45,000, depending on your space size and project scope. A typical full bathroom remodel with quality fixtures, professional tile work, and necessary plumbing updates usually runs $20,000 to $35,000.
The biggest cost drivers are plumbing changes and fixture selection. Keeping your toilet, sink, and shower in existing locations saves significantly on plumbing costs. Moving these fixtures requires additional rough plumbing work that can add $2,000 to $5,000.

Most bathroom renovations in Lake Ronkonkoma take 3 to 6 weeks from start to finish. Standard renovations with new fixtures, tile work, and vanity installation typically require 3-4 weeks. Complete remodels involving layout changes, plumbing relocations, or extensive custom work can take 5-6 weeks.

Absolutely. Lake Ronkonkoma’s diverse housing stock includes homes from the 1940s through today, and we’ve successfully renovated bathrooms in houses from every era. Older homes often require plumbing updates, electrical improvements, or structural modifications that we handle routinely.
Common older-home challenges include outdated galvanized plumbing that needs replacement, electrical systems requiring upgrades to current codes, and structural modifications to accommodate modern fixtures and layouts. We assess these requirements during initial consultation and include necessary updates in your project estimate.
